From mboxrd@z Thu Jan 1 00:00:00 1970 From: =?UTF-8?Q?Christian_K=c3=b6nig?= Subject: Re: [PATCH 04/13] drm/amdgpu/gmc9: Adjust xgmi offset Date: Thu, 6 Sep 2018 09:39:06 +0200 Message-ID: References: <1536161364-4280-1-git-send-email-Shaoyun.Liu@amd.com> Reply-To: christian.koenig-5C7GfCeVMHo@public.gmane.org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8"; Format="flowed" Content-Transfer-Encoding: base64 Return-path: In-Reply-To: <1536161364-4280-1-git-send-email-Shaoyun.Liu-5C7GfCeVMHo@public.gmane.org> Content-Language: en-US List-Id: Discussion list for AMD gfx List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: amd-gfx-bounces-PD4FTy7X32lNgt0PjOBp9y5qC8QIuHrW@public.gmane.org Sender: "amd-gfx" To: shaoyunl , amd-gfx-PD4FTy7X32lNgt0PjOBp9y5qC8QIuHrW@public.gmane.org Cc: Alex Deucher QW0gMDUuMDkuMjAxOCB1bSAxNzoyOSBzY2hyaWViIHNoYW95dW5sOgo+IEZyb206IEFsZXggRGV1 Y2hlciA8YWxleGFuZGVyLmRldWNoZXJAYW1kLmNvbT4KPgo+IE9uIGhpdmVzIHdpdGggeGdtaSBl bmFibGVkLCB0aGUgZmJfbG9jYXRpb24gYXBlcnR1cmUgaXMgYSBzaXplCj4gd2hpY2ggZGVmaW5l cyB0aGUgdG90YWwgZnJhbWVidWZmZXIgc2l6ZSBvZiBhbGwgbm9kZXMgaW4gdGhlCj4gaGl2ZS4g IEVhY2ggR1BVIGluIHRoZSBoaXZlIGhhcyB0aGUgc2FtZSB2aWV3IHZpYSB0aGUgZmJfbG9jYXRp b24KPiBhcGVydHVyZS4gIEdQVTAgc3RhcnRzIGF0IG9mZnNldCAoMCAqIHNlZ21lbnQgc2l6ZSks Cj4gR1BVMSBzdGFydHMgYXQgb2Zmc2V0ICgxICogc2VnbWVudCBzaXplKSwgZXRjLgo+Cj4gRm9y IGFjY2VzcyB0byBsb2NhbCB2cmFtIG9uIGVhY2ggR1BVLCB3ZSBuZWVkIHRvIHRha2UgdGhpcyBv ZmZzZXQgaW50bwo+IGFjY291bnQuIFRoaXMgaW5jbHVkaW5nIG9uIHNldHRpbmcgdXAgR1BVVk0g cGFnZSB0YWJsZSAgYW5kICBHQVJUIHRhYmxlCj4KPiBBY2tlZC1ieTogSHVhbmcgUnVpIDxyYXku aHVhbmdAYW1kLmNvbT4KPiBBY2tlZC1ieTogU2xhdmEgQWJyYW1vdiA8c2xhdmEuYWJyYW1vdkBh bWQuY29tPgo+IFNpZ25lZC1vZmYtYnk6IFNoYW95dW4gTGl1IDxTaGFveXVuLkxpdUBhbWQuY29t Pgo+IFNpZ25lZC1vZmYtYnk6IEFsZXggRGV1Y2hlciA8YWxleGFuZGVyLmRldWNoZXJAYW1kLmNv bT4KPiBSZXZpZXdlZC1ieTogRmVsaXggS3VlaGxpbmcgPEZlbGl4Lkt1ZWhsaW5nQGFtZC5jb20+ Cj4gLS0tCj4gICBkcml2ZXJzL2dwdS9kcm0vYW1kL2FtZGdwdS9hbWRncHVfZ21jLmMgIHwgNCAr KysrCj4gICBkcml2ZXJzL2dwdS9kcm0vYW1kL2FtZGdwdS9nZnhodWJfdjFfMS5jIHwgMyArKysK PiAgIGRyaXZlcnMvZ3B1L2RybS9hbWQvYW1kZ3B1L2dtY192OV8wLmMgICAgfCA2ICsrKysrKwo+ ICAgMyBmaWxlcyBjaGFuZ2VkLCAxMyBpbnNlcnRpb25zKCspCj4KPiBkaWZmIC0tZ2l0IGEvZHJp dmVycy9ncHUvZHJtL2FtZC9hbWRncHUvYW1kZ3B1X2dtYy5jIGIvZHJpdmVycy9ncHUvZHJtL2Ft ZC9hbWRncHUvYW1kZ3B1X2dtYy5jCj4gaW5kZXggNmFjZGVlYi4uYTk1YjYxNSAxMDA2NDQKPiAt LS0gYS9kcml2ZXJzL2dwdS9kcm0vYW1kL2FtZGdwdS9hbWRncHVfZ21jLmMKPiArKysgYi9kcml2 ZXJzL2dwdS9kcm0vYW1kL2FtZGdwdS9hbWRncHVfZ21jLmMKPiBAQCAtMTU4LDYgKzE1OCwxMCBA QCB2b2lkIGFtZGdwdV9nbWNfZ2FydF9sb2NhdGlvbihzdHJ1Y3QgYW1kZ3B1X2RldmljZSAqYWRl diwgc3RydWN0IGFtZGdwdV9nbWMgKm1jKQo+ICAgCWlmICgoc2l6ZV9iZiA+PSBtYy0+Z2FydF9z aXplICYmIHNpemVfYmYgPCBzaXplX2FmKSB8fAo+ICAgCSAgICAoc2l6ZV9hZiA8IG1jLT5nYXJ0 X3NpemUpKQo+ICAgCQltYy0+Z2FydF9zdGFydCA9IDA7Cj4gKwllbHNlIGlmIChtYy0+eGdtaS5u dW1fcGh5c2ljYWxfbm9kZXMpCj4gKwkJbWMtPmdhcnRfc3RhcnQgPSBtYy0+dnJhbV9zdGFydCAr Cj4gKwkJCShtYy0+eGdtaS5udW1fcGh5c2ljYWxfbm9kZXMgLSBtYy0+eGdtaS5waHlzaWNhbF9u b2RlX2lkKQo+ICsJCQkqIG1jLT54Z21pLm5vZGVfc2VnbWVudF9zaXplOwoKVGhhdCBsb29rcyBp bmNvbXBsZXRlIHRvIG1lLiBUaGUgY2FsY3VsYXRpb24gYWJvdmUgYXMgd2VsbCBhcyB0aGUgQUdQ IApjb2RlIG5lZWRzIGFkanVzdG1lbnQgYXMgd2VsbC4KClByb2JhYmx5IGJlc3QgaWYgc29tZSBm Yl9zdGFydC9mYl9lbmQgZmllbGRzIHRvIHN0cnVjdCBhbWRncHVfZ21jIGFuZCAKY2FsY3VsYXRl IHRoYXQgb25seSBvbmNlIGluIGFtZGdwdV9nbWNfdnJhbV9sb2NhdGlvbi4KCkNocmlzdGlhbi4K Cj4gICAJZWxzZQo+ICAgCQltYy0+Z2FydF9zdGFydCA9IG1jLT5tY19tYXNrIC0gbWMtPmdhcnRf c2l6ZSArIDE7Cj4gICAKPiBkaWZmIC0tZ2l0IGEvZHJpdmVycy9ncHUvZHJtL2FtZC9hbWRncHUv Z2Z4aHViX3YxXzEuYyBiL2RyaXZlcnMvZ3B1L2RybS9hbWQvYW1kZ3B1L2dmeGh1Yl92MV8xLmMK PiBpbmRleCBkNDE3MGNiLi41ZTlhYjhlIDEwMDY0NAo+IC0tLSBhL2RyaXZlcnMvZ3B1L2RybS9h bWQvYW1kZ3B1L2dmeGh1Yl92MV8xLmMKPiArKysgYi9kcml2ZXJzL2dwdS9kcm0vYW1kL2FtZGdw dS9nZnhodWJfdjFfMS5jCj4gQEAgLTQ0LDYgKzQ0LDkgQEAgaW50IGdmeGh1Yl92MV8xX2dldF94 Z21pX2luZm8oc3RydWN0IGFtZGdwdV9kZXZpY2UgKmFkZXYpCj4gICAJCQlSRUdfR0VUX0ZJRUxE KHhnbWlfbGZiX2NudGwsIE1DX1ZNX1hHTUlfTEZCX0NOVEwsIFBGX0xGQl9SRUdJT04pOwo+ICAg CQlpZiAoYWRldi0+Z21jLnhnbWkucGh5c2ljYWxfbm9kZV9pZCA+IDMpCj4gICAJCQlyZXR1cm4g LUVJTlZBTDsKPiArCQlhZGV2LT5nbWMueGdtaS5ub2RlX3NlZ21lbnRfc2l6ZSA9IFJFR19HRVRf RklFTEQoCj4gKwkJCVJSRUczMl9TT0MxNShHQywgMCwgbW1NQ19WTV9YR01JX0xGQl9TSVpFKSwK PiArCQkJTUNfVk1fWEdNSV9MRkJfU0laRSwgUEZfTEZCX1NJWkUpIDw8IDI0Owo+ICAgCX0KPiAg IAo+ICAgCXJldHVybiAwOwo+IGRpZmYgLS1naXQgYS9kcml2ZXJzL2dwdS9kcm0vYW1kL2FtZGdw dS9nbWNfdjlfMC5jIGIvZHJpdmVycy9ncHUvZHJtL2FtZC9hbWRncHUvZ21jX3Y5XzAuYwo+IGlu ZGV4IDM1MjljNTUuLjBkYTg5YmEgMTAwNjQ0Cj4gLS0tIGEvZHJpdmVycy9ncHUvZHJtL2FtZC9h bWRncHUvZ21jX3Y5XzAuYwo+ICsrKyBiL2RyaXZlcnMvZ3B1L2RybS9hbWQvYW1kZ3B1L2dtY192 OV8wLmMKPiBAQCAtNzcwLDEyICs3NzAsMTggQEAgc3RhdGljIHZvaWQgZ21jX3Y5XzBfdnJhbV9n dHRfbG9jYXRpb24oc3RydWN0IGFtZGdwdV9kZXZpY2UgKmFkZXYsCj4gICAJdTY0IGJhc2UgPSAw Owo+ICAgCWlmICghYW1kZ3B1X3NyaW92X3ZmKGFkZXYpKQo+ICAgCQliYXNlID0gbW1odWJfdjFf MF9nZXRfZmJfbG9jYXRpb24oYWRldik7Cj4gKwkvKiBhZGQgdGhlIHhnbWkgb2Zmc2V0IG9mIHRo ZSBwaHlzaWNhbCBub2RlICovCj4gKwliYXNlICs9IGFkZXYtPmdtYy54Z21pLnBoeXNpY2FsX25v ZGVfaWQgKiBhZGV2LT5nbWMueGdtaS5ub2RlX3NlZ21lbnRfc2l6ZTsKPiAgIAlhbWRncHVfZ21j X3ZyYW1fbG9jYXRpb24oYWRldiwgJmFkZXYtPmdtYywgYmFzZSk7Cj4gICAJYW1kZ3B1X2dtY19n YXJ0X2xvY2F0aW9uKGFkZXYsIG1jKTsKPiAgIAlpZiAoIWFtZGdwdV9zcmlvdl92ZihhZGV2KSkK PiAgIAkJYW1kZ3B1X2dtY19hZ3BfbG9jYXRpb24oYWRldiwgbWMpOwo+ICAgCS8qIGJhc2Ugb2Zm c2V0IG9mIHZyYW0gcGFnZXMgKi8KPiAgIAlhZGV2LT52bV9tYW5hZ2VyLnZyYW1fYmFzZV9vZmZz ZXQgPSBnZnhodWJfdjFfMF9nZXRfbWNfZmJfb2Zmc2V0KGFkZXYpOwo+ICsKPiArCS8qIFhYWDog YWRkIHRoZSB4Z21pIG9mZnNldCBvZiB0aGUgcGh5c2ljYWwgbm9kZT8gKi8KPiArCWFkZXYtPnZt X21hbmFnZXIudnJhbV9iYXNlX29mZnNldCArPQo+ICsJCWFkZXYtPmdtYy54Z21pLnBoeXNpY2Fs X25vZGVfaWQgKiBhZGV2LT5nbWMueGdtaS5ub2RlX3NlZ21lbnRfc2l6ZTsKPiAgIH0KPiAgIAo+ ICAgLyoqCgpfX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fX19fXwph bWQtZ2Z4IG1haWxpbmcgbGlzdAphbWQtZ2Z4QGxpc3RzLmZyZWVkZXNrdG9wLm9yZwpodHRwczov L2xpc3RzLmZyZWVkZXNrdG9wLm9yZy9tYWlsbWFuL2xpc3RpbmZvL2FtZC1nZngK